Sanza orders (Captain) and the crew to prepare the fishing nets. When they ask how, he replies that they need to figure it out for themselves. Without any other options, (Captain) and the others begin searching for the nets.



Because of the duplicitous stall merchant, and the guards they had bought off, (Captain) and the crew were in jail.
In order to make their bail, the crew accept Sanza's aid in return for agreeing to work on his explorer ship.
Now that the explorer ship has left for open water, it has no means of making contact with the rest of the world.
(Captain) and the crew prepare themselves for the strict lifestyle of open-sea fishing.

(Captain), Lancelot and Vane manage to get some nets, when Vane says he isn't feeling well, and has indeed turned a strange shade of green. The crew members are expressing their sympathies for him, when a monster lands on the deck of the explorer ship. To carry on preparations of the nets, (Captain) and the crew prepare to take the monster out.
